- Tree of Pease Planted at Queen’s Park by NoRooz Educational Foundation* 1986 was designated as the International Year of Peace by the United Nations. To Mark this Year, a White Pine Tree of Pease Was Planted by Dr, George Ignatieff on June 26, 1986 at Queen’s Park. *The New Day Foundation-the forerunner of Norooz Foundation was registered in 1985 by Sussan Ekrami and Dr. Cuyler Young Jr., the then Director of the Royal Ontario Museum, as co-founders. The first honorary chairman of the board was Ambassador George Ignatieff who was the Chancellor of the University of Toronto at the time

- Ignatieff Memorial by NoRooz Educational Foundation* In 1991, in gratitude, and in memory of Dr. Ignatieff a ceremony was held at the Trinity College, University of Toronto and a red oak tree was planted at the entrance of the George Ignatieff Theatre. The plaque was subsequently unveiled in 1992. *The New Day Foundation-the forerunner of Norooz Foundation was registered in 1985 by Sussan Ekrami and Dr. Cuyler Young Jr., the then Director of the Royal Ontario Museum, as co-founders. The first honorary chairman of the board was Ambassador George Ignatieff who was the Chancellor of the University of Toronto at the time

- Hakimi Ave The City changed the name of Lebovic Avenue (located west of Warden Avenue, between Eglinton Avenue East and Ashtonbee Road) to Hakimi Avenue on Oct 18, 2008. The street was chosen in part because a 20-year old Hakim Optical outlet was relocated when the City extended Lebovic Avenue in 2007. The City generally does not name streets after living people, but an exception was granted out of respect for Hakim’s entrepreneurial, business and philanthropic achievements.

- On November 23, 2012 Dr. Mahabadi was invested as Officer of the Order of Canada by His Excellency the Right Honourable David Johnston, Governor General during the investiture ceremony held at Rideau Hall in Ottawa. Officer of the Order of Canada is one of Canada’s highest civilian honors, which recognizes a lifetime of outstanding achievement dedication to community and service to the nation. Dr. Mahabadi is recognized for his significant contributions to the advancement of science and innovation in Canada. Photo Credit: Dr. Hadi Mahabadi’s website
